Responsibilities



Handling all aspects of our food operation - Receiving, Prepping and Preparing our food for all of our guests Responsible for high levels of team work and communication with all employees and management Providing feedback about our quality of food and preparation to our management so we can challenge our quality food program and areas in which we may be more efficient.

Candidate Profile



A passion for food quality and working with a close-knit team A willingness to own the food program Belief in and passion for Market - Eat at Paz's core values. A true team player, willing to get your hands dirty and do whatever it takes to keep our store running smoothly. Personal characteristics reflective of Market - Eat at Paz: self-motivated, positive attitude, service-oriented, flexible, fun-loving personality, and ethical with a high degree of integrity Desire to work in a complex, fast paced start-up environment. Desire to make an impact on customers and team members. A can-do work ethic and the ability to take initiative on projects. Strong organization, communication and planning skills. Willingness to learn - thru hands on mentorship you'll learn how to prepare food and beverages to standard recipes or customized for customers, including recipe changes such as temperature, quantity of ingredients or substituted ingredients. Availability to work flexible hours that may include early mornings, evenings, weekends, nights and/or holidays Previous Restaurant Experience preferred Food Safe is an asset but not required - Training would be offered
